In [[occult]] and [[divination]], the suit is connected with the classical element of [[earth (element)|earth]], the physical body and possessions or wealth. Coins as a Latin suit represent the feudal class of traders, and therefore to worldly matters in general. It can be associated with physical characteristics such as dark hair and eyes, dark complexion, and a sturdy build.


In the [[Rider–Waite Tarot]] deck and derivative decks, the suit is called the suit of Pentacles, and each card incorporates one or more coin-like disks with a pentacle carved into them. In the [[Thoth Tarot]], it is called the suit of discs, and the cards are associated with the [[Taurus]], [[Virgo]] and [[Capricorn]] signs of the [[Zodiac]].
